If you know the answer please give units :) Part A: The reactant concentration in a zero-order reaction was 5.00×10^?2M after 140s and 3.00×10^?2M after 300s. What is the rate constant for this reaction? -> For this I got that 1.25x10^-4M/s, which was labeled right. Part B: What was the initial reactant concentration for the reaction described in Part A? -> The hint given is: Use the integrated rate law for zero-order reactions to solve for [A]_0. Values for [A] and t are given in Part A, and your answer to Part A was the value of k. Part C: The reactant concentration in a first-order reaction was 6.10×10^?2M after 20.0s and 2.00×10^?3 after 95.0s. What is the rate constant for this reaction? Part D: The reactant concentration in a second-order reaction was 0.650M after 215s and 5.70×10^?2M after 900s. What is the rate constant for this reaction?
